Danfoss AC Drive VLT 2800 Specifications
| Feature | Specification |
|---|---|
| Supported Software Version | Ver. 2.6x/2.x (for VLT 2800 Profibus DP V1) |
| Baudrate Adjustment | Automatic, adjusts to master configuration |
| Profibus Cable Impedance | 135 to 165 ohm (3 to 20 MHz) |
| Profibus Cable Resistance | < 110 ohm/km |
| Profibus Cable Capacity | < 30 pF/m |
| Profibus Cable Damping | Max. 9 dB (whole wire length) |
| Profibus Cable Cross Section | Max. 0.34 mm2 (AWG 22) |
| Profibus Cable Type | Twisted pairs (1x2, 2x2, or 1x4 wires), Copper-braided or braided/foil screen |
| Max. Drop Cable Length (9.6-93.75 kBaud) | 96 m per segment |
| Max. Drop Cable Length (187.5 kBaud) | 75 m per segment |
| Max. Drop Cable Length (500 kBaud) | 30 m per segment |
| Max. Drop Cable Length (1.5 MBaud) | 10 m per segment |
| Max. Drop Cable Length (3-12 MBaud) | None (direct connection recommended) |
| Max. Total Bus Cable Length (1 segment, 9.6-187.5 kBaud) | 1000 m (32 nodes, 31 VLTs) |
| Max. Total Bus Cable Length (1 segment, 3-12 MBaud) | 100 m (32 nodes, 31 VLTs) |
| Control Word / Main Reference Update Time (tint) | Max. 26 msec. |
| Status Word / Actual Output Frequency Update Time (tint) | Max. 26 msec. |
| Parameter Read (PCD 1-8) Update Time (tint) | 40 msec. |
| Parameter Write (PCD 1-2) Update Time (tint) | 160 msec. |
| Parameter Read (PCV) Update Time (tint) | 41 msec. |
| Parameter Write (PCV) Update Time (tint) | 40 msec. |
| Acyclical Data (single read, write) Update Time (tint) | 40 msec. |
| Profibus DP Communication Standard | EN 50170, part 3 |
| Supported Profibus Profile | PROFIDRIVE Profile for frequency converters (version 2 and partly 3, PNO) |
Danfoss AC Drive VLT 2800 Details
The Danfoss AC Drive VLT 2800, when equipped with a PROFIBUS interface, functions as a sophisticated slave in a fieldbus network, communicating with masters like PLCs or PCs. This setup grants comprehensive control and monitoring capabilities, enabling the exchange of various information and commands. It adheres to the PROFIBUS fieldbus standard EN 50170, part 3, facilitating interoperability with compliant masters.
A core feature is the use of Parameter-Process Data Objects (PPOs), which are optimized for rapid cyclical data transfer. PPOs can carry both process data, such as control words and speed references, and parameters for configuration. Different PPO types offer flexibility in data size and content, supporting fixed 4-byte process data alongside parametrable parts of 8 or 16 bytes for user-selected parameters.
The system supports both Profibus DP V0 and the extended DP V1 functionalities. While DP V0 primarily handles cyclical data exchange, DP V1 introduces acyclical communication. This allows a Master type 1 (e.g., PLC) to perform acyclical read/write operations on parameters in addition to cyclical data. A Master type 2 (e.g., PC tool) can dynamically establish or abort acyclical connections, even when a Master type 1 is active.
PCA handling, part of the PPO, enables the master to control and supervise parameters, request responses, and receive spontaneous messages from the slave. Requests and responses operate on a handshake basis, ensuring data integrity. The slave can transmit spontaneous messages when active parameters change, like warnings or alarms, provided parameter 917 (Spontaneous messages) is active. Fault codes are also communicated through this mechanism, detailing reasons for rejected requests.
Another powerful feature includes the Synchronize and Freeze functions, designed for coordinated control and feedback in multi-slave systems. SYNC/UNSYNC commands facilitate simultaneous reactions like synchronized starts or speed changes across multiple drives. FREEZE/UNFREEZE commands allow for simultaneous readings of process data, ensuring synchronized feedback from all connected slaves. This is crucial for applications requiring tight coordination.
The manual also details crucial operational parameters, such as Protocol select (800) for defining the PROFIBUS protocol, and Bus time out (803/804), which dictates the drive's behavior if communication is lost. Options range from freezing the output frequency to triggering a trip. The Control Word (CTW) and Status Word (STW) are central to control, with selectable profiles (PROFIDRIVE or Danfoss FC). These 16-bit words define commands to the drive and feedback on its operational status, respectively.
Warning and alarm messages are distinctly handled. Alarms cause the VLT 2800 to enter a fault condition requiring master acknowledgment and fault clearance before resuming operation. Warnings, conversely, indicate conditions without interrupting the process. Both can trigger spontaneous messages. Physical connection guidelines, including cable connection, screen grounding, and bus termination, are critical for EMC compliance and reliable communication.
